                      Big Al


                      At 7:45 pm, our selection is on the TCU Horned Frogs minus the points over Oregon St. There's not much that can be said about TCU that hasn't already. The 6th-ranked Horned Frogs are absolutely loaded this season. Last year, Gary Patterson's men went 12-0 before losing to Boise State 17-10 in the Fiesta Bowl. That defeat to Boise created a lot of motivation over the summer to prepare for this season, and go undefeated. And with 16 returning starters back (9 offense; 7 defense), an undefeated season and a National Championship is not out of the question. TCU's strength under Patterson has been its defense, and it ranked #1 last year (239.7 yards against) in the country. Admittedly, TCU might not be as good this season, given the departure of DE Jerry Hughes and LB Daryl Washington, as well as CBs Nick Sanders and Rafael Priest. But its offense should be better than last year's edition, which ranked 7th in the nation in total yards. QB Andy Dalton will lead the squad, and his mobility makes him a dangerous dual threat on offense. This will be a particularly tough match-up for Mike Riley's Beavers, as they'll be breaking in a new quarterback in sophomore Ryan Katz. And his #1 target, senior WR James Rodgers, missed part of practice last week to nurse a bruised shoulder (though he is expected to suit up). This game will be played at Cowboys Stadium in Arlington, TX (just down the road a short ways from TCU's home in Fort Worth), and the huge capacity (almost double that of TCU's Amon G. Carter Stadium) should fire up the Frogs. Oregon State has had its difficulties playing on the road to start a season, as it's 0-9 ATS its last nine road games in September, and 13-33 ATS since 1980! NCAA Roadkill on TCU. Lay the points. Good luck, as always...Al McMordie.
